Transaction 595b613142d4134f005a727d9071b4fcafc11379875e9d854e1fcfe52cc3b572

block
3d8e61cdcaf455d81a7caf92d918c76d91fce9e8efb10729549d0f10c8a54c40

1 Input

3 Outputs